Re: COWBOYS pants
The Cowboys are famous for their white color scheme being mixed up, especially as it pertains to the pants. While they have had grey and even silver pants over the years, the strange color blueish pants they made famous came from Tex Schramm. Legend has it that he wanted to use the same color as the material in the seats of his wife’s car at the time. The star on the helmet was royal blue for a time, and the numbers on their whites were navy for a good chunk of the 70s. Schramm had the Cowboys wear white at home to highlight the visiting teams’ colors in part and to market the NFL more greatly as a whole. Most other teams wore dark colors at home at that time. Dallas also forced opposing teams to be situated on the sunny side of the stadium, thus they'd be in darker colors in the sun while Dallas was in more cooling white. Anything to get a leg up o the competition!
